Mt. Pleasant boys hang on
Andy Krutsinger
Feb. 10, 2020 12:00 am
BURLINGTON - It wasn't easy, but the Mt. Pleasant boys basketball team finished off the season sweep of Burlington on Friday night, clinging on in the fourth for a 49-46 win over their newest Southeast Conference rivals.
The Panthers had to battle back after a slow start. Burlington led 14-5 after the first quarter but Mt. Pleasant dominated the second period 23-3 to take a 28-17 advantage into halftime.
After splitting the third quarter 9-9, the Grayhounds put together a run in the fourth quarter. Burlington scored 20 points in the final eight minutes, their best output of the night, but Mt. Pleasant still walked out with a three-point win.
Brody Bender led the way with 14 points for the Panthers. Clayton Lowery and Jaxon Hoyle scored 13 points apiece. Keegan Kohorst finished with four points and six assists. Jack Johnson had three points, and Brevin Wilson had two.
Mt. Pleasant is now 10-8 overall and 5-4 in the SEC. They'll play at Ottumwa tonight (Monday).
